Last but not least, the Scottish line of the Stuarts is supposed to go back to Joseph of Arimathea ; the … WebJun 25, 2024 · Like Jesus’ male disciples, Mary Magdalene appears to have come from Galilee. She was with him at the beginning of his ministry in Galilee and continued after his execution. The name Magdalene suggests her origin as the town of Magdala (Taricheae), on the Sea of Galilee's western shore.
